學習Android一定要會java的,因為android的開發至少目前是在一個純java的開發環境中進行的,android的學習基本上是學習如何運用它的控件以及各個組件,但是要實現這些控件和組件必須要用到java,不排除以后使用c#也可以進行android的開發。因此java是個基礎,要想讓自己變成一個Android達人,所以一定要潛下心來好好把java的基礎學習一下。其實java是一門很容易學習的語言。
需要學java,不需要學c語言
不需要的,可以直接進行安卓學習,但可以了解了解。
應該是要學的
也不一定要學習C語言,實際上,學習語言,主要是培養你的邏輯思維。而且C語言的結構,相對合理。但至少要學習一門語言,?比較合理。
1、iOS平臺開發語言為Objective-C
2、安卓 Android開發語言為java
這里說的Objective-C,java都是編程語言程序。當然,能實現編程的語言不止上述兩種。
Objective-C是擴充C的面向對象編程語言。Objective-C流行的主要原因可能是它是為數不多一種可以為iPhone和iPad編程的語言。
Java是一種可以撰寫跨平臺應用程序的面向對象的程序設計語言。Java 技術具有卓越的通用性、高效性、平臺移植性和安全性,廣泛應用于PC、數據中心、科學超級計算機、同時擁有全球較大的開發者專業社群。
若想自己寫APP,那么得學以上中一種語言。Objective-C需要一點C或C++的基礎。
ios用的是objective-c,也是面向對象的開發。
android用的是java,既然你學的java,android的開發更容易上手,但是apple的app開發工具更為友好方便。
apple的app store是可以收費賺錢。但是如果做apple的app開發,你需要有一臺mac,因為xcode等apple開發工具需要在蘋果的系統下運行,還需要在apple store申請購買開發資格。需要先期投入資金。
android的開發沒有這些限制。